Agile Sessions: The Beat of Successful Teams

In the dynamic world of software development, high-performing teams thrive on a steady beat. This rhythm is established by Agile ceremonies, short, focused events that provide structure and transparency throughout the development process. From daily briefings to iterative cycles, these ceremonies foster collaboration, communication, and continuous advancement. They act as checkpoints, ensuring everyone is aligned on goals, challenges, and progress, ultimately driving efficient outcomes of high-quality software.

  • Morning Syncs: A brief gathering where team members share their accomplishments, roadblocks, and plans for the day.
  • Sprint Planning: The ceremony where the team selects user stories from the product backlog to be worked on during the upcoming sprint.
  • Feedback Meeting: A demonstration of the completed work from the sprint to stakeholders, gathering feedback and validating progress.
  • Post-Mortem Meeting: A dedicated time for the team to analyze what went well, what could be improved, and identify actionable steps for future sprints.

Rapid Delivery: From Code to Customer in a Flash

In today's fast-paced technological landscape, companies need to be agile and responsive. This means deploying new software often to meet evolving customer expectations. Continuous delivery is the approach that enables this rapid cycle cycle, ensuring that code goes from development to production automatically.

Using continuous integration and automated testing, developers can confidently merge changes into a shared codebase. This simplifies the development process and reduces the risk of errors. Once code is validated, it's automatically created and deployed to a production setting.

This approach brings numerous advantages including faster time to market, improved customer satisfaction, and lessened development costs. By embracing continuous delivery, enterprises can stay ahead of the competition and deliver exceptional software experiences.

Continuous Integration Systems: Building Quality into Every Iteration

In today's fast-paced development environments, delivering superior quality software is paramount. Continuous Integration (CI) has emerged as a crucial practice to achieve this goal by automating the build and test processes. By regularly merging code changes into a shared repository and commencing automated builds and tests, CI helps uncover issues early in the development cycle. This proactive approach not only improves software quality but also diminishes the risk of costly defects later on.

  • Continuous Integration supports collaboration among developers by providing a shared platform for code merging and testing.
  • Also, CI promotes faster feedback loops, allowing developers to tackle issues swiftly.
  • By including automated tests into the build process, CI confirms that code changes do not introduce new bugs or regressions.

For this reason, CI plays a vital role in delivering reliable software that meets customer expectations.

Mastering the Definition regarding Done: Achieving Software Excellence

In the ever-evolving world in software development, achieving excellence is a continuous journey. A crucial element in this pursuit is mastering a definition concerning done. Explicitly defining what constitutes "done" provides a firm foundation for successful project delivery and high-quality software. When members have a shared understanding regarding the criteria for completion, it mitigates ambiguity, fosters collaboration, and promotes that deliverables meet expectations.

  • A well-defined "definition of done" serves as a roadmap, supporting teams to focus their efforts and prioritize tasks effectively.
  • Moreover, it streamlines communication and reduces the risk for misunderstandings, leading to smoother workflows and increased productivity.

By establishing a clear and comprehensive definition for done, development teams can unlock software excellence, delivering value-driven solutions that meet both functional and non-functional requirements.
